Kim Kardashian can now add “Makeup Master” to her never-ending list of achievements. The reality star and her longtime makeup artist, Mario Dedivanovic, staged a makeup seminar Saturday titled “The Master Class” at the Pasadena Civic Conference Center.

Hundreds of fans of all shapes and sizes showed up to witness Dedivanovic work his magic on Kardashian’s face. The Los Angeles Times reported fans lined up outside the venue as they waited to get inside to learn Kardashia’s secrets. Some people came from as far away as Sweden, Ecuador and Abu Dhabi.

Tickets for the event ranged from $300 to $1,000. Apart from the four-hour seminar, attendees were also given gift bags filled with the pair’s favorite beauty products, along with a certificate of completion. The fans who opted for premium tickets were able to have their pictures taken with the reality star and the celebrity makeup artist.

The Mirror reported “High School Musical” star Ashley Tisdale was among the hundreds of people who attended the event. The actress is readying a fashion blog called The Haute Mess to be launched Wednesday. She admitted on an Instagram post she learned a lot from Kardashian and Dedivanovic.

Apart from sharing their beauty secrets, Kardashian also spoke about her professional relationship with Dedivanovic. The pair have worked together for more than eight years, and she told the attendees about the secret of the longevity of their artist-client partnership.

“You have to know, if you’re gonna be in someone’s face and keep the job, you have to definitely be more on the quiet side,” she said. “He’s always given me my space. He’s helped me through so many things, but still never stepped over that boundary,” she said.
